A's Outlasted by Astros in Slugfest

BOX SCORE

The A's cranked five balls over the wall Wednesday in Houston, but still fell three runs short to the Astros' offense in an 11-8 road loss.

Khris Davis went deep twice while Matt Olson, Jed Lowrie and Ryon all hit homers too. 

Jesse Hahn only lasted two innings in his start on the hill. He allowed six earned runs off nine hits. 

The A's are now 35-43 on the year.
